UDOIT was originally created by the University of Central Florida and rapidly became a popular open-source solution. UCF did not have the resources to provide ongoing enterprise support for UDOIT users, so they sought a partnership with Cidi Labs as a means of providing a supported UDOIT solution to the Canvas community.
In 2019, Cidi Labs began offering UDOIT as a fully supported cloud solution and has continued to add value to it since.
Cidi Labs is the exclusive hosting and support provider for UDOIT Advantage, offering a solution for institutions who wish to not self-host and self-support their use of the UDOIT open source codebase.
Cidi Labs provides ongoing code updates, bug fixes, and maintenance for its subscribers. We wrap our services with a service level agreement (SLA) as well as a support portal where you can report bugs and find answers to common support questions.

UDOIT checks accessibility issues course-by-course, whereas DesignPLUS assists with accessibility page-by-page while editing page content.
The two solutions are quite complimentary in that you can use DesignPLUS to ensure you create accessible page content during page creation. You then use UDOIT to check all the content in a course on a course-by-course basis. Both solutions are helpful for fixing issues found.
Together your faculty will be equipped with the tools they need to ensure content they produce not only looks nice, but meets accessibility requirements long after the course is in use.

UDOIT is provided as a SaaS subscription with the annual subscription price based on organizational FTE or student count (in K-12).
A small implementation and training fee is applied in Year 1 of all subscriptions. This covers installation and set up as well as a few hours of training to get you started.
